20150207899 | GLOBAL ADDRESS LIST - Configurations for providing a data feed of contact information updates, deletes, and additions to one or more clients are disclosed. A contact information server can maintain a log including respective log entries of different updates (e.g., in a log structure data store) performed on the contact information. The contact information server orders the log entries using associated timestamps in order to be consistent with the actual order of updates performed on the contact information. For synchronizing contact information, a client will submit a query and supply a timestamp to the contact information server to request the log of updates based on the timestamp (e.g., log entries corresponding to a set of updates since the included timestamp). The server will respond with one or more modifications to the contact information represented as the set of updates in respective log entries. | 07-23-2015 |

20080258670 | Open-Loop Torque Control on Joint Position-Controlled Robots - A joint of a robot is controlled by a torque command. The joint has a position controller with a position feedback loop. The torque command is received for the joint, and a velocity feedforward command is determined for realizing the torque command using the position controller. The velocity feedforward command is sent to the position controller and the position feedback loop is canceled. The position feedback loop is canceled by sending a position command to the position controller, where the position command is an actual measured position of the joint. The position feedback loop is also canceled by setting the gain of the position feedback loop to zero. | 10-23-2008 |

20140380237 | Zoom View Mode for Digital Content Including Multiple Regions of Interest - Techniques are disclosed for a zoom view mode for use with digital content including multiple regions of interest. Regions of interest may include portions of viewable digital content (e.g., panels of a comic book). In some cases, the mode may be invoked using a zoom command (e.g., double tap) to zoom in on a region of interest. After the mode has been invoked, the user may shift from one region of interest to another using a shift command (e.g., swipe), along a shift path of motion. The shift path of motion may have a non-constant speed and/or non-linear shape (e.g., arc-shaped). In some cases, the shift path of motion speed may be defined by a non-linear easing function curve. In some cases, the mode may be configured to present an entire page when first shifting to a region of interest on that page, to provide overall context to the user. | 12-25-2014 |
